Daniel Hayes Ramis (born August 10, 1994) is an American actor and filmmaker, and the son of the late Harold Ramis, who played Egon Spengler in the original Ghostbusters films. Growing up as the youngest child of Harold Ramis, he developed an interest in creative work that eventually led him both in front of and behind the camera.
In Ghostbusters: Answer the Call (2016), Daniel Ramis appeared as Metal Head, the fan at the Stonebrook Theatre who gives Rowan North a high five during a rock concert sequence. His casting was a direct tribute to his father, who had died in 2014, and the role connected the Ramis family to the franchise in a new generation.
Beyond acting, Daniel Ramis has worked as a producer and filmmaker. His short film Dingus Wishes (2018), an eight-minute comedy drama, received a nomination for Best Professional Short (Narrative) at the Chicago Southland International Film Festival. He followed that with another short, Everything Is Fine (2019).
